Block 68,532
Block Hash
faf96e7ddf549b5de33577ab47159f485f4b1c0f52dee020f61945f0385423e7
Previous Block Hash
486afcc30471d47a157b41c70b71c65fa0511851cf46246e10d73daded6f7521
Mined
Transactions
3
Difficulty
1.40 M
Size
4,946 bytes
Transactions (3)
1 input, 1 output
500,000.1427
PEPE
21 inputs, 1 output
10,499,999.99416
PEPE
10 inputs, 4 outputs
2,303,578.62055585
PEPE